The Language of Alcohol offers a bold, honest, and practical approach to understanding addiction that goes far beyond the surface of traditional recovery programs. Drawing from his own life experiences and deep therapeutic insight, author Phillip Wister reveals how alcoholism and addictive behavior are not merely about substance use-but are rooted in the hidden language, learned patterns, and unspoken rules that shape our emotional world.
Rather than subscribing to a one-size-fits-all methodology, this book presents a non-12-step recovery framework that empowers readers to see addiction through a new lens: as a set of conditioned responses shaped by family dynamics, coping strategies, and communication patterns. Through vivid personal stories and clear psychological analysis, Wister exposes the ingrained behaviors that fuel self-destructive cycles and offers tools for dismantling them.
